Common Payroll Tax Errors and How to Avoid Them
Payroll processing can be a challenging undertaking for businesses, and mistakes in calculating and submitting payroll assessments are surprisingly common. Typical blunders include incorrect worker classification (mislabeling someone as an contract employee), incorrect salary calculations, failing to withhold the proper amount for national and state income assessments, and misreporting Social Security and Medicare portions. To eliminate these expensive challenges, consistently review your payroll processes, utilize dependable payroll applications, keep abreast of changing tax rules, and consider obtaining assistance from a professional payroll advisor. Maintaining detailed records is also essential for examination purposes.
